Meaning, origin, history

The name Hayaan is of Arabic origin and its meaning is "joyous" or "happy". It is derived from the Arabic word 'haya', which means life or laughter. The name is often used in Islamic cultures as a way to express hope for a joyful and happy life. Hayaan has been traditionally passed down through generations in many Middle Eastern families, particularly among Muslims. However, it has gained popularity worldwide in recent years due to its positive meaning and sound. It is considered unisex, although it is more commonly used for boys. The name Hayaan does not have any specific historical figures associated with it, but its usage can be traced back centuries through various Arabic texts and literature. Its popularity has waxed and waned over time, but it remains a beloved name in many communities around the world today. In terms of pronunciation, Hayaan is typically pronounced as "Hi-yan" with the stress on the first syllable. The name does not have any specific nicknames or variants, although some people may shorten it to "Haya". Overall, Hayaan is a unique and meaningful name with deep roots in Arabic culture.
